Bill Summary

This bill would supplement the "Eminent Domain Act of 1971," P.L.1971, c.361 (C.20:3-1 et seq.), to provide that just compensation for an easement over a portion of beachfront property condemned for the purpose of dune construction or beach replenishment must include consideration of the increase in value to the entire property due to the added safety and property protection provided by the dune or replenished beach. The bill would also provide that any additional rights of the public to access property held in the public trust arising as a result of the easement, or the dune construction or beach replenishment, would not be considered to cause a diminution in the value of the entire property.

AI Summary

This bill amends the "Eminent Domain Act of 1971" to ensure that when the government takes an easement (a right to use someone's property for a specific purpose) over beachfront property for dune construction or beach replenishment, the property owner receives "just compensation" that accounts for the increased value of their entire property due to the added protection from the dune or replenished beach. It also clarifies that any new public access rights to the property that arise from this project will not be used to reduce the compensation owed to the property owner.
